i received my havi b3s
 
haha i'll have to remind myself never to trust head-fi again, you guys hype stuff up way too much
 
i'll give it to you guys; the havis are airy, but only compared to other in ears.
 
if you guys think these have some magically huge soundstage or something, you're quite mistaken, and/or never touched an open headphone before. hd650/he400 beats these by a mile, no contest whatsoever. then again, these are $60 earbuds sooo...what was i expecting? i guess the IEM game has been quite ****ty for awhile for these to be "insanely good for the price"
 
 
separation is very very good though, ESPECIALLY for an IEM, helps a lot with the detail.
 
overall, yes, i'd say these were worth the $60. i would not pay more than $100, especially considering how uncomfortable/unwieldy these are for an iem.
 
really makes me rethink whether i really want to pay big money for ciems...at this point i honestly feel like if i went with ciems, it'd be a huge downgrade from my home setups.
